Snow Abu Dhabi is throwing a fun run for kiddos

Snow Abu Dhabi is throwing a fun run for kiddos

Think fun runs are all about the sweat and sunburn? Think again.
Snow Abu Dhabi is flipping the script – and the season – with the return of the Snow Fun Run, a wintry racecourse for kids aged 6 to 14 taking place in actual snow.
Yep, you read that right. The capital's coolest indoor destination is hosting a fun-fuelled, frost-covered challenge where little adventurers can dash through a 400-metre track in sub-zero temperatures – all without leaving the UAE.
Back for its second edition on Saturday, May 31, the event is organised in partnership with Abu Dhabi Sports Council and is packed with icy action.
Kids will not only race against the clock, but also collect tokens throughout the course to enter a prize raffle at the end (because nothing says motivation like mystery prizes and hot chocolate at the finish line).
The run is split into age groups so everyone gets a fair crack at snow-glory:
6 to 8 years – Race starts at 8.30am
– Race starts at 8.30am 9 to 11 years – Race starts at 9am
– Race starts at 9am 12 to 14 years – Race starts at 9.30am
Every young participant will bag a commemorative medal, a souvenir t-shirt and yes, a steaming cup of hot chocolate to warm those fingers.
Adults aren't left out either – all under-14s must be accompanied by a grown-up who gets free access to the cheering zone. Expect plenty of good vibes, cosy snacks and family-friendly energy throughout the morning.
The Snow Fun Run is all about keeping kids active, engaged and excited about fitness – without sweating it out in the summer heat. It's part of Snow Abu Dhabi's wider calendar of community events focused on building healthy habits and making sport a blast.
Registration closes May 29, so get those snow boots ready.
From Dhs85. Sat May 31, from 8.30am. Snow Abu Dhabi, Reem Mall. skidxb.com.

Spartan Race announces new Trifecta Weekend at Al Ain Zoo

Spartan Middle East will host a Trifecta Weekend at Al Ain Zoo, the obstacle course racing brand announced today. To be held from October 11-12, 2025, the event will feature all three signature race formats across the weekend, allowing competitors to earn the Trifecta medal at one venue. Both open and competitive heats will run for the Sprint, Beast, and Kids races. Spartan Middle East brings obstacle course racing to Al Ain Zoo The race schedule includes the Sprint 5K, featuring a 5km course with 20 obstacles. The Super 10K presents a 10km course with 25 obstacles, whilst the Beast 21K covers 21km with 30 obstacles. Kids races will offer courses of 1km for ages 4-6, 1.5km for ages 7-9, and 3km for ages 9-14. Participants can earn a Spartan Trifecta by completing the Sprint, Super, and Beast within a calendar year. The weekend format allows racers to complete all three races over two days, earning a commemorative Trifecta medal alongside individual race wedges. The course will run through Al Ain Zoo's grounds, positioning obstacles amongst elephants, giraffes, and other wildlife. This marks the first time a Spartan race has taken place within a zoo environment. The Abu Dhabi Sports Council supports the event, continuing a partnership that has promoted obstacle course racing across the emirate. Abu Dhabi hosts the annual Spartan World Championship, which attracts over 6,000 participants and has contributed to the sport's growth in the region. Isla Watt, Director of Spartan Middle East, said in a statement: 'We are incredibly excited to bring a full Trifecta Weekend to a venue as spectacular as Al Ain Zoo. The combination of our challenging races and this stunning natural environment creates a truly memorable event. We encourage participants and their families to make a weekend of it, explore the garden city of Al Ain, and experience a Spartan event like no other.' Registration has opened, with organisers encouraging early sign-ups to secure places. Further information and registration details are available at

There's going to be a Spartan Race at Al Ain Zoo and it looks epic

Get ready to channel your inner warrior – Spartan Race is returning to the UAE and this time it's going wild. On October 11 and 12, 2025, the action-packed Spartan Trifecta Weekend lands at Al Ain Zoo, bringing mud, muscle and adrenaline to one of the region's most unexpected venues. That's right – your next obstacle could come with a side of zebra spotting or a giraffe in the background. The two-day event is no ordinary race. It's a full Trifecta weekend, meaning you can complete all three of Spartan's signature races – Sprint, Super and Beast – in one go. Conquer all three and you'll earn the elite Trifecta medal (plus serious bragging rights). Here's what to expect: Sprint (5K, 20 obstacles): A fast, fierce challenge – great for beginners or anyone short on time. A fast, fierce challenge – great for beginners or anyone short on time. Super (10K, 25 obstacles): A middleweight test of endurance, strength and grit. A middleweight test of endurance, strength and grit. Beast (21K, 30 obstacles): Spartan's most brutal course, designed to push even the fittest competitors to their limits. Spartan's most brutal course, designed to push even the fittest competitors to their limits. Kids' Races (1–3K): Little Spartans aren't left out, with age-appropriate courses for kids 4 to 14. This is the first time Spartan is setting its obstacle course inside a zoo, so expect a completely unique course layout that winds through the animal exhibits, natural trails and garden landscapes of Al Ain Zoo. The race blends world-class sport with wild scenery – and it's designed to be just as memorable for spectators as it is for athletes. Backed by the Abu Dhabi Sports Council, the event builds on the UAE's growing reputation as a global hub for obstacle racing. With the annual Spartan World Championship already a highlight of the capital's sporting calendar, this new event in Al Ain adds yet another must-do weekend to the UAE's race season. If you're not racing, go cheer on the athletes, bring the kids, or just soak in the zoo-meets-obstacle energy. If you are racing, it's time to start training, folks! From Dhs236. Ail Ain Zoo. Oct 11-12. HYROX attracts over 3,500 athletes from 124 nationalities in Abu Dhabi

21 July 2025 14:13 ABU DHABI (WAM) The Abu Dhabi Sports Council, in collaboration with HYROX and ADNEC Abu Dhabi, hosted HYROX, the world's largest indoor fitness race and the leading fitness event in the Middle event, held on Sunday, brought together 3,506 athletes from across the globe, including 213 professional represented 41 percent of the participants, with the 30-35 age group being the most from 124 nationalities took part, including 340 Emiratis. The United Kingdom led the participant demographics with 24 percent, followed by the UAE with 9 percent, and both Ireland and the Philippines with 5.25 percent race consisted of eight 1km running rounds, interspersed with eight functional fitness workouts, forming a complete challenge that tested both strength and was open across several categories: Individual (Men and Women), Doubles (Men, Women, Mixed), Doubles Pro, Individual Pro, Relay Teams (4 persons), and a dedicated category for People of event kicked off with the men's category at 7:00 am, followed by the remaining categories throughout the day, concluding with the men's relay at 9:00 ceremonies began at 12:45 pm after the first race and continued until 10:45 pm after the final event. The race witnessed an impressive public turnout of over 12,000 spectators throughout the Director of the Events Sector at Abu Dhabi Sports Council, Talal Al Hashemi, stated, "Hosting HYROX in Abu Dhabi underscores our ongoing commitment to promoting sports and a healthy lifestyle by attracting world-class events that blend challenge and excitement while being inclusive of all community segments. This aligns with the national initiative 'Year of the Community,' which reflects our leadership's vision of building a cohesive and thriving society."In turn, Humaid Matar Al Dhaheri, Managing Director and Group Chief Executive Officer of ADNEC Group, said, 'Our collaboration with the Abu Dhabi Sports Council and HYROX reaffirms our commitment to attracting leading global events that promote the principles of a balanced and healthy lifestyle for all members of the community."HYROX is one of the fastest-growing fitness racing events globally and has become a key fixture in Abu Dhabi's sports calendar. It blends running with functional fitness in a standardised format designed to accommodate all fitness levels.
